What Is the History of Iowa City, Iowa?
Iowa City boasts a rich and meaningful history that reflects the broader development of the American Midwest:
- Founded in 1839 β It served as the original capital of Iowa before the capital was moved to Des Moines.
- Home to the University of Iowa β Established in 1847, it was one of the first public universities to admit men and women on an equal basis.
- Cultural Hub β Iowa City was designated a UNESCO City of Literature in 2008 β the first in the U.S.
- Architectural Highlights β The Old Capitol Building, which once served as the seat of government, now sits at the center of the universityβs campus.
This blend of history and progress makes Iowa City a truly unique student destination.
What Are Some Interesting Facts About Iowa City?
- Iowa City is one of only two UNESCO Cities of Literature in the U.S.
- The University of Iowa is home to the world-famous Iowa Writers' Workshop.
- Over 33,000 students attend the University of Iowa annually.
- The city has a rich legacy of Midwestern hospitality and community engagement.
- Iowa City consistently ranks among the best college towns in America.

What Are the Best Travel and Transportation Options for Students in Iowa City?
Iowa City offers student-friendly transportation with free Cambus services, affordable public buses, bike-friendly routes, and walkable neighborhoodsβmaking daily commutes to campus and around town easy and cost-effective.
Public Buses
- Operated by Iowa City Transit and Cambus (free for UI students)
- Regular service across campus and town
Biking
- A bike-friendly city with lanes and racks throughout
- Many students use bicycles as their main mode of transportation
Walking
- Most neighborhoods near the university are pedestrian-friendly
Rideshare & Car Rentals
- Services like Uber, Lyft, and Zipcar are readily available
Students enjoy free transit services, minimal commute times, and sustainable ways to get around campus.
What Are the Must-Visit Tourist Attractions in Iowa City?
Iowa City offers a vibrant mix of cultural, historical, and outdoor experiences. Students can enjoy art, live performances, local events, scenic walks, and weekend activities that enrich their university life.
- Old Capitol Museum β A symbol of Iowaβs early government and history
- Iowa Avenue Literary Walk β Honoring famous writers with sidewalk plaques
- Hancher Auditorium β World-class performances in a stunning modern venue
- The Englert Theatre β Hosting concerts, films, and community events
- Devonian Fossil Gorge β A unique geological site perfect for outdoor enthusiasts
Whether you're a literature lover, music fan, or nature explorer, Iowa City has something for everyone.
